Post by CAJames on 09/30/22 at 15:52:06

My suggestion is to try it with no input connected and see if the problem persists. If it does you can try moving it to a different circuit in a different room and/or trying new tubes and/or talking to Steve. High frequency noise sounds more like electromagnetic interference (EMI) or possibility a noisy tube than a ground loop to me, but I don't claim to be an expert so JMO/FWIW/YMMV and all that.
